Basic Information Overview

  • Category: Integrated Circuit
  • Use: Clock Generator and Multiplier
  • Characteristics: Low jitter, high frequency accuracy, programmable output frequencies
  • Package: 32-QFN (Quad Flat No-Lead)
  • Essence: Clock generation and multiplication for various electronic systems
  • Packaging/Quantity: Tape and Reel, 250 units per reel

Specifications and Parameters

  • Input Voltage Range: 2.375V to 3.63V
  • Output Frequency Range: 1kHz to 808MHz
  • Number of Outputs: 4
  • Output Types: LVCMOS, LVDS, HCSL
  • Programmable Features: Output frequency, output type, spread spectrum modulation, phase offset, etc.

Functional Characteristics

The SI5338F-B03250-GMR is a highly versatile clock generator and multiplier. Its key functional characteristics include:

  • Low jitter: Provides precise and stable clock signals for sensitive applications.
  • High frequency accuracy: Offers accurate output frequencies to meet system requirements.
  • Programmable output frequencies: Allows customization of output frequencies based on specific needs.
  • Spread spectrum modulation: Reduces electromagnetic interference (EMI) by spreading the energy of the clock signal over a wider frequency range.
  • Phase offset: Enables synchronization and alignment of multiple clock signals.

Working Principles

The SI5338F-B03250-GMR utilizes a combination of phase-locked loop (PLL) and fractional-N synthesis techniques to generate and multiply clock signals. It takes an input reference frequency and uses internal dividers, multipliers, and phase detectors to generate multiple output frequencies with high accuracy and low jitter.
